Round 6 Summer Series 21st April 2024

The weather forecast was for rain and on this day the forecast was correct!!

On arrival at the harbour we were greeted with rain showers and chilly light winds.

We assembled in the shelter and our esteemed Commodore took the opportunity to give the competitors an update on matters relating to the club. 

In particular, a plea to help run our fun club. The greatness of any club/organisation is the sum of the energy that is put into the club. That energy typically comes from too few who eventually burn out and clubs then fold. To be sustainable, a club must have many members putting in small amounts of energy on a regular reliable basis. Please put your hand up if you can add a little bit of energy to our fun club.

The rain continued and we had a vote to hold the event or abandon - 100% said ''let's go racing". Hardy lot this WMRMYC crew.

Andrew and Peter sent the upgraded BouyBots out onto the course and the racing began.

We dodged a few heavy showers and managed to complete 7 races in a light southerly, variable breeze.

John our dedicated scorer, dressed in his old jackaroo gear, worked on the results while Trevor and Ian sat outside in the rain having a beer. Odd behaviour??

Congratulations to everyone.
